Kaipionmetsä nature trail is a short forest outing in Kaipio Forest in Jupperi. Along the route, 11 boards introduce local trees, plants, terrain, and animals. The boards also include tasks that encourage children to observe nature with different senses. Blue markers make the route easier to follow, but the terrain is difficult in places.

- Accessibility
- The route is not accessible and is not a good plan with ordinary strollers. Official sources describe the route as difficult in places, and the Service Map lists the surface material as ground.
Plan your visit
- Practical notes
- The route starts from the yard of Tammenterho cottage at Tammipääntie 33, 02730 Espoo. According to the City of Espoo page, the yard has parking space for several cars, and the nearest bus stop is Rinnetie. The noticeboard beside Tammenterho cottage has more information about the nature trail.
- Opening-hours notes
- The route has no set opening hours. Because the Tammenterho yard is the starting point, plan the visit for daylight and be mindful of the community cottage yard.

- Age notes
- Works best for children around 4-12 who can manage a short forest path and enjoy stopping at task boards. With younger children, the difficult sections may slow the visit down.
- Seasonal notes
- Best during snow-free conditions, when the blue markers and task boards are easy to see. Wet or icy forest ground can make the difficult sections harder with children.
- Weather notes
- Best in dry weather. Rain can make the ground-surface path slippery or muddy, which can make even the short route feel harder with children.
